Elements of suckler scheme to be retained

Agriculture Minister Simon Coveney has indicated that at least some aspects of the suckler welfare scheme will be retained — even though the five-year scheme has run its course.

“We need to weigh up how we can hold on to what has been really important for the scheme,” Mr Coveney told an Oireachtas joint committee debate on the Agriculture, Food and the Marine Dept’s expenditure ceiling.

“There are strategic aspects of the suckler cow welfare scheme which have been beneficial for Irish agriculture, yet were not anticipated at the start, such as data collection on breeding, how animals respond to feed conversion efficiency and age.
